They will file an action in your name and fight to secure an equitable settlement or verdict. Asbestos lawsuits usually seek compensation from manufacturers of asbestos-containing products. The companies knew asbestos was harmful, but they continued to use it to make a profit. In the end, a lot of asbestos companies filed for bankruptcy and were forced to save money in trust funds to pay victims. Trust funds today comprise more than $30 billion in compensation for mesothelioma. The mesothelioma compensation can cover lost income, medical expenses as well as pain and suffering and emotional stress. These payouts can help victims and their families deal with their new realities. A mesothelioma lawsuit will also hold negligent companies responsible and ensure that they don't repeat their mistakes. Asbestos sufferers may also be qualified for financial compensation through VA benefits. This kind of compensation is offered to veterans who were exposed to asbestos while in the military, and have developed mesothelioma or another asbestos-related disease. In addition veterans who served on or built US Navy ships and warships may be eligible for additional compensation from the VA.
